>> Currently kernel provides a way to change tx rate of single VF in
>> switchdev mode via tc-police action. When lots of VFs are configured
>> management of theirs rates becomes non-trivial task and some grouping
>> mechanism is required. Implementing such grouping in tc-police will bring
>> flow related limitations and unwanted complications, like:
>> - tc-police is a policer and there is a user request for a traffic
>>   shaper, so shared tc-police action is not suitable;
>> - flows requires net device to be placed on, means "groups" wouldn't
>>   have net device instance itself. Taking into the account previous
>>   point was reviewed a sollution, when representor have a policer and
>>   the driver use a shaper if qdisc contains group of VFs - such approach
>>   ugly, compilated and misleading;
>> - TC is ingress only, while configuring "other" side of the wire looks
>>   more like a "real" picture where shaping is outside of the steering
>>   world, similar to "ip link" command;
>>
>> According to that devlink is the most appropriate place.
